I went last year and yesterday!

Last year was lovely. We went on a weekday and it was alot quieter. We browsed the german market and looked at what the stalls were selling. There was lovely food (London prices - for example £5.50 for an angus burger with cheese and onions). The funfair is good with rides for all ages but that can get expensive!

Yesterday was a nightmare! It was packed and we could barely move. I found it quite dangerous for small children. I felt safest carrying Jake or putting him in the pram and Amelia in the sling. We didn't enjoy it so much as we couldn't see anything. They even had to stop people coming into the market area as it gets bottlenecked what with being at the entrance.

I'd say it is worth it but go on a weekday if possible. And if you want to ice-skate, go on the big wheel etc pre-book online. Theres also a free visit to see Santa but on a busy day the queue could be 2 hours long!!!!

Get there early on a weekday and you should be ok! We also walked into Knightsbridge after and browsed in Harrods!
